    TY 2018 ExplnOfNonFilingWithAGStmt
    Name:
    THE PEARCE FOUNDATION
    EIN:
    34-6572300
    Statement:
    The Ohio Attorney General requires that charitable organizations operating or organized within the State submit an annual registration through an online portal that highlights key information from the Form 990-PF for public disclosure purposes. The Trust completes this registration as required in lieu of furnishing a copy of its Form 990-PF to comply with the specific reporting instructions of the State of Ohio.
